Itinerary

Day 1
Welcome to Christchurch

On arrival at Christchurch Airport you’ll be transferred to your hotel. This evening meet your Tour Director and fellow travellers for a welcome reception and dinner.

Hotel: Ibis Hotel Christchurch

Included Meals: Dinner

Day 2
Christchurch – Omarama

Board your coach to see the extensive work carried out to rebuild the city after the devastating earthquake of February 2011. Later, see Lakes Tekapo and Pukaki, visit the Church of the Good Shepherd and soak up the alpine scenery of Mount Cook National Park.

Hotel: Heritage Gateway Hotel, Omarama

Included Meals: Breakfast and dinner

Day 3
Omarama – Dunedin

Your day starts along the Waitaki River and the Waitaki Hydro Power Scheme and Benmore Dam. Then travel through Oamaru, with its famous white limestone buildings, to Dunedin where you’ll take a tour of the city. Visit New Zealand’s only castle, Larnach Castle and its stunning gardens.

Hotel: Kingsgate Hotel Dunedin

Included Meals: breakfast and dinner

Day 4
Dunedin – Milford Sound

Today is a feast for the senses. Travel along the Devil’s Staircase and the shores of Lake Wakatipu to Te Anau. You’ll be awestruck by the World Heritage Fiordland National Park, New Zealand’s largest. See rainforest, ancient glaciers, mountain ranges and drive through the Homer Tunnel. Pass Lake Matheson, Pop’s Lookout, Cleddau Valley and the Chasm, before arriving in Milford Sound for your overnight cruise on the Milford Mariner. Day 5-7
Milford Sound – Queenstown

Day 5: Milford Sound – Queenstown

This morning depart for Te Anau, on the shores of Lake Te Anau, the largest lake on the South Island. You’ll explore the Te Anau Glow Worm Caves by boat with local guide, before travelling to the adventure-capital Queenstown.

Day 6: Queenstown ‘Free Time’

A full day to see the sights of your choice. Take it easy with a wine tour or walk on the wild side with a jet boat ride or white water rafting (all own expense). Whatever you choose, Queenstown will surprise and exhilarate.

Day 7: Queenstown ‘Free Time’

Another action-packed day or time to relax. Tonight ride the Skyline Gondola to Bob’s Peak for a buffet ‘highlight dinner’ at the Skyline Restaurant.

Day 8
Queenstown – Franz Josef

Visit the gold mining village of Arrowtown. Then enjoy the tastes of delicious stone fruit at Cromwell. See a trio of lakes, Dunstan, Hawea and Wanaka. Travel over the Haast Pass, view amazing Thunder Creek Falls then it’s on to majestic Franz Josef Glacier, the world’s most accessible glacier.

Hotel: Scenic Hotel Franz Josef Glacier (Graham Wing)

Included Meals: Breakfast and dinner

Day 9
Franz Josef – Punakaiki

See Franz Josef Glacier from the air or take a glacier hike (both own expense). Depart for Hokitika, home of the native greenstone (jade), for a factory visit and demonstration. Later, travel to Punakaiki to view the Pancake Rocks and Blowholes. You’ll stay in an eco-friendly resort right on the waterfront. Enjoy dinner while watching the thundering surf at your doorstep!

Day 10-11
Punakaiki – Nelson

Day 10: Punakaiki – Nelson

Soak up the scenic wilderness of the Heritage Highway through the impressive Buller Gorge and the Kahurangi National Park before arriving in Nelson. This afternoon you’ll visit the World of Wearable Arts and Collectable Cars.

Day 11: Nelson ‘Free Time’

On this day at leisure, you’ll have the option to journey to the top of the South Island and enjoy a relaxing cruise in the Abel Tasman National Park. Or perhaps take a short bush walk, relax in sunny Nelson or explore the many arts and craft shops.

Day 12-13
Nelson – Wellington

Day 12: Nelson – Wellington

Visit the seaside village of Picton and cruise on tranquil Queen Charlotte Sound, before you head across the Cook Strait to Wellington, New Zealand’s capital. Enjoy a city sights tour before you visit Maori Cultural Icon Te Papa, the Museum of New Zealand, where you’ll explore New Zealand’s nature, art, history and cultural heritage.

Day 13: Wellington ‘Free Time’

A free day to see the sights. Perhaps take a tour of Parliament or one of the Lord of the Rings movie tours, or even cruise to Somes Island in Wellington Harbour (own expense).

Day 14
Wellington – Napier

Travel through the dairy farming land of Manawatu to Napier. Enjoy a city walking tour with a local guide and learn how Napier was rebuilt after a devastating Earthquake in 1931.

Day 15-16
Napier – Rotorua

Day 15: Napier – Rotorua

Travel past Lake Taupo, the largest lake in New Zealand. Visit the mighty Huka Falls and then it’s on to Rotorua. On arrival a sightseeing tour takes in views of Lake Rotorua.


Maori Cultural Icon This evening enjoy a Maori Hangi feast ‘highlight dinner’ and concert at the Tamaki Family Marae.

Day 16: Rotorua

Maori Cultural Icon Visit Te Puia, the Maori Arts and Crafts Institute, where you’ll see demonstrations of wood carving and weaving. Then tour the geothermal valley and hear about the importance of the geysers and mud pools to the Maori people.

Day 17
Rotorua – Auckland

Visit the Agrodome Sheep Show, the multi-award-winning stage show, to gain an insight into agricultural life in New Zealand. You’ll see the art of sheep shearing, sheepdog demonstrations, cow milking, bottle feeding of lambs and an exciting sheep auction. Visit the farming community of Matamata to experience a farming demonstration before a delicious lunch at Longlands Farm. Continue to Auckland where your city sightseeing tour takes in Bastion Point, Viaduct Harbour and the Auckland Harbour Bridge.
